    Default suspension, let me see if i got this right

    hey guys. from allll the dozens of posts ive read let me see if ive got this right!

    ive got an 05 vz berlina with 20's (225/35/20)

    i want to lower it a little...

    SO ill need:

    King Springs SL rear
    King Springs L front
    Rear camber kit
    Rolled rear guards

    that sound right??

    any thoughts on stuff or suggestions?? i dont wana be chewing 20" tyres ay

    As i said before, camber kits arent neccesary on these as the rears are adjustable to a certain extent anywayz.. although i do suggest getting a wheel alignment after a few Km's as the wheels will sit differently after the springs settle..

    Quote Originally Posted by Ray-915 View Post
    hmmmm impulsive you got scrub from lowering it 2inchs? sounds like im gunna need mine rolled too, nervous bout that
    okay sorry, 'About' 2 inches.. i didnt get a ruler out and measure it.. i also have 245 R19's.. before you get the guards rolled find out where it scrubs ie lower it, then do a test drive, usually it will wear on the guard where it needs to be rolled, depending how much, do what i did
